Narrative:
The student pilot reported that, during the eleventh landing, they did not correct for a decreasing airspeed and stalled the airplane about 5 to 10 ft above the runway surface. The student pilot attempted to correct with throttle; however, the airplane dropped and impacted the runway hard on the right main landing gear followed by a ground swerve to the right then left. The right wing struck the runway which resulted in substantial damage to the right wing spar. The flight instructor reported that there were no preaccident mechanical failures or malfunctions with the airplane that would have precluded normal operation.

Probable Cause: The student pilot's failure to maintain adequate airspeed during the final approach, which resulted in an inadvertent aerodynamic stall. Contributing to the accident the flight instructor's delayed remedial action.
